News & Information : In Contract Magazine : May/June 2007 : New MLS Data Field helps agents comply with HB150 (Minimum Services Law) New MLS Data Field helps agents comply with HB150 (Minimum Services Law)House Bill 150 (Minimum Services Law): New MLS Data Field for ListingsThe symbol and wording for Limited Representation be changed from LR to LS and in the future described as Limited Service. Please note that a change was made to the Add/Edit section of the CBR MLS TEMPO system that now will prompt you with the question "Negotiation with Seller Permission: Yes or No". This is a required entry for (1) entering a new listing or (2) editing an existing listing. The CBR MLS TEMPO system will allow the REALTOR® to select up to two listing agreement types for each listing (depending on your agreement with the seller) and they will choose from the following list of possible combinations:
Any of these listing agreement types could be selected but ERS/EA and EO/LR are not available since they are mutually exclusive. If any of the Listing Agreement Types are selected either individually or in combination, the REALTOR® is prompted with the following question that is REQUIRED to be answered.
If you answer Yes to this question, the REALTOR® is prompted to fill in these two OPTIONAL data fields:
Remember ... any change made to any listing that was entered prior to the creation of this new data field will result in having to answer the "Negotiation with Seller Permission Yes No" question. For more information on this new legislation, please refer to www.columbusrealtors.com/15904.cfm. |
